Seoul health officials have announced that free influenza vaccinations will commence on the 21st of March, as reports suggest that flu cases in the city have tripled the usual seasonal levels. This development comes amid growing concern over a potentially severe flu season, prompting urgent preventive measures by local authorities. The decision aims to curb the spread of the virus and protect vulnerable populations.

The Seoul Metropolitan Government confirmed that the number of reported flu cases has significantly increased, with unofficial estimates indicating a threefold rise compared to previous years at this time. The surge has prompted health authorities to accelerate vaccination efforts, offering free flu shots starting from March 21st at designated clinics across the city. Officials emphasize that the vaccination campaign is part of a broader strategy to mitigate the impact of a potentially severe flu season, especially amid ongoing concerns about other respiratory illnesses circulating in the community.

Health officials have not yet provided detailed data on the exact number of cases or the geographic distribution within Seoul but have acknowledged that the spike is notable compared to the same period in previous years. The government has urged residents, particularly high-risk groups such as the elderly, children, and those with chronic conditions, to take advantage of the free vaccination program. The initiative is expected to run for several weeks, with additional outreach planned to maximize coverage.

Recent Trends and Past Flu Seasons in Seoul

Influenza outbreaks in Seoul typically peak between late winter and early spring, with case numbers varying annually based on virus strains and vaccination coverage. Historically, the city has experienced fluctuations, but a tripling of cases at this stage is unusual and has raised alarms among public health officials. Past seasons with similar surges have sometimes led to increased hospitalizations and deaths, especially among high-risk groups.

The current situation appears to be influenced by multiple factors, including possible changes in circulating virus strains, lower-than-expected vaccination rates last season, or reduced immunity in the population. The Seoul government has previously emphasized the importance of vaccination, but coverage levels have varied. The current spike may reflect gaps in herd immunity or increased virus transmissibility.
